Output 3b5af588482de092a4cf9da1fd0093d18d2892f93ec54e791efc940b07ff5ee7:1

value
687589
script pubkey
OP_0 OP_PUSHBYTES_20 697511f91c07b434263204a146e705f0acee3aaf
address
bc1qd963r7guq76rgf3jqjs5dec97zkwuw40eax82t
transaction
3b5af588482de092a4cf9da1fd0093d18d2892f93ec54e791efc940b07ff5ee7
spent
true